Jun 6, 2018 · At least two of the wounds on Kathleen Peterson’s scalp are in the shape of the talons of a barred owl, as shown on autopsy photos; The tiny wounds on Kathleen’s face are consistent with the tip of an owl’s beak; A feather was found on Kathleen Peterson’s body; A twig was found in dried blood on Kathleen Peterson’s body

Kathleen Peterson was found dead at the bottom of a staircase in her home in Durham, North Carolina in December 2001. Her husband, Michael Peterson, was initially charged with her murder and was eventually convicted of first-degree murder in 2003. Kathleen's mysterious death was first chronicled in 2004 in the 13-part documentary The Staircase, which Netflix later revisited with three new episodes in 2018.. The case is also the subject of a new eight-part HBO drama of the same name, starring Colin Firth and Toni Collette, which was released on May 5..
